Interest rate




Interest rate is one of the most important economic concepts that you need to understand if you want to make smart financial decisions. It's the price you pay to borrow money, and it affects everything from your mortgage payments to your savings account balance.

Interest rates are set by central banks, such as the Federal Reserve in the United States. The Fed uses interest rates to control inflation and economic growth. When inflation is too high, the Fed raises interest rates to slow down the economy. When economic growth is too slow, the Fed lowers interest rates to stimulate the economy.


Interest rates can also be affected by supply and demand. When there is more demand for money than there is supply, interest rates will rise. When there is more supply of money than there is demand, interest rates will fall.


Interest rates have a big impact on your personal finances. If interest rates are high, it will cost you more to borrow money. This can make it more difficult to buy a house, a car, or other major purchases. If interest rates are low, it will cost you less to borrow money. This can make it easier to save for the future or invest in your business.

Here are some tips for understanding interest rates:

  • Interest rates are expressed as a percentage
  • The higher the interest rate, the more you will pay to borrow money
  • Interest rates can be fixed or variable
  • Fixed interest rates stay the same for the life of the loan
  • Variable interest rates can change over time
